Strempel & Partners Advises Vive La Vie SpA on Its Acquisition, With Telvia SpA, of LSE Listed Elitel Telecom SpA
Strempel & Partners Srl, a Milan-based Corporate Finance firm, is pleased to announce the acquisition by its client Vive La Vie SpA and Telvia SpA of 58.01% of Elitel Telecom SpA -- an Italian company listed on the AIM market of the London Stock Exchange. A further step in the transaction calls for this stake to increase to 67% by October 31st, 2007. Vive La Vie was advised by Strempel & Partners' corporate finance team led by David Strempel and Davide Ferrero with legal advisory services provided by Alberto Valfrè of the law firm Studio Grande Stevens.
Medical Devices Get Most Funding in Slow Stretch for VC: Mid-Year Results from Healthcare Corporate Finance News
Mid-year results reveal that the last time the health care venture capital market experienced such a slow six-month stretch was the second half of 2005. During the six months ended June 30, 2008, based on deals with disclosed prices of $1 million or more, 208 health care venture capital deals were announced totaling $3.58 billion. The second quarter ended June 30, 2008 produced 105 deals totaling $1.66 billion.
DeSilva+Phillips Client The Winner's Circle Organization Sold to Barron's
DeSilva+Phillips, media investment bankers, announces that its client, The Winner's Circle® Organization, was sold to Barron's, published by Dow Jones & Company. The Winner's Circle Organization, based in Boca Raton, Florida, is a consulting firm which provides analysis of financial advisory practices and rankings of advisors based on assets under management, revenue generation and practice quality. DeSilva+Phillips Corporate Finance, LLC, advised The Winner's Circle Organization in the transaction.
